Electrical Engineering is the 31st most popular major in the country with 30,670 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, electrical engineering gra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$70,098 and had an average of $23,581 in loans still to pay off.
Across Indiana, there were 796 electrical engineering graduates with average earnings and debt of $69,080 and $25,035 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 167 electrical engineering graduates with average earnings and debt of $55,737 and $39,894 respectively.

Top 4 Best Value Master’s Degree Colleges for Electrical Engineering in Indiana
Out of the 4 schools in the Best Value EE Schools for a Master’s in Indiana that were part of this year’s ranking, Purdue University - Main Campus landed the #1 spot on the list. West Lafayette, Indiana is the setting for this large institution of higher learning. The public school handed out masters’s EE degrees to 82 students in 2019-2020.
In addition to being on our indiana master’s degree ee students list, Purdue has also earned the #2 rank in our “Best Electrical Engineering Master’s Degree Schools in Indiana” ranking. Average graduate tuition and fees at Purdue University - Main Campus are $28,794, but you may pay more or less depending on your major.
You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Purdue University Northwest. The school came in at #2 for the Best Value EE Schools for a Master’s in Indiana. Hammond, Indiana is the setting for this medium-sized institution of higher learning. The public school handed out masters’s EE degrees to 22 students in 2019-2020.
In addition to being on our indiana master’s degree ee students list, Purdue Northwest has also earned the #4 rank in our “Best Electrical Engineering Master’s Degree Schools in Indiana” ranking. Although you might pay more or less depending on your area of study, average graduate tuition and fees at Purdue University Northwest are $11,633.
Out of the 4 schools in the Best Value EE Schools for a Master’s in Indiana that were part of this year’s ranking, Indiana University - Purdue University - Indianapolis landed the #3 spot on the list. Located in Indianapolis, Indiana, this large public school handed out 46 diplomas to qualified masters’s EE students in 2019-2020.
IUPUI not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#3 on our “Best Electrical Engineering Master’s Degree Schools in Indiana” list. Average graduate tuition and fees at IUPUI are $26,013, but you may pay more or less depending on your major.
You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of Notre Dame. It ranked #4 on our 2022 Best Value EE Schools for a Master’s in Indiana list. Notre Dame is located in Notre Dame, Indiana and, has a fairly large student population. In 2019-2020, this school awarded 14 masters’s EE degrees to qualified students.
Notre Dame did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#1 on our “Best Electrical Engineering Master’s Degree Schools in Indiana” list. Although you might pay more or less depending on your area of study, average graduate tuition and fees at University of Notre Dame are $57,522.
